The effect of benzoxazole unit on the properties of cyclic thiourea functionalized triphenylamine dye sensitizers

2021 
Abstract Two D-π-A-A sensitizers (AZ6-B20 and AZ6-B21) were synthesized by inserting the benzoxazole group as an auxiliary acceptor between the π-linker and the acceptor. And a D-A-π-A sensitizer (AZ6-B19) was also synthesized in our previous works by the insertion of the benzoxazole between the donor and the π-linker. The effects of benzoxazole groups on the properties at different sites of dye sensitizers were distinguishing. Their light harvest abilities were investigated by UV-vis spectra both in the solution and on the films. The results show that the absorption bands of UV-vis spectra are quite different from D-A-π-A and D-π-A-A dyes. The much more intensive molar extinction coefficients (53807 M-1cm-1 and 52555 M-1cm-1) were observed at around 575 nm for D-π-A-A dyes. The photovoltaic properties of DSSCs were also evaluated by J-V curves and IPCE measurements. The results confirmed that D-π-A-A dyes delivered high photovoltaic efficiency (AZ6-B20: 7.48%, AZ6-B21: 8.67%) compared with that of D-A-π-A dye (AZ6-B19: 3.27%). The details on the relation of the structures/properties were discussed by the optical physical absorption, electrical chemical measurements and DFT calculations.
